#03b698 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03b698 is composed of 1.2% red, 71.4%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 169.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 36.3%. #03b698 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ffff with #006d31.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#03b698 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#03b698 has RGB values of R:3, G:182,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 243352.

Shades and Tints of #03b698
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000807 is the darkest color, while #f4f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#03b698
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58615f is the less saturated color, while #03b698 is the most saturated one.
